Thoughts Of Us At The Start Of The Day.



Fragments of soon to be forgotten dreams
Fade with the coming of the light.
Flowing into reppressed streams
That flow deep beyond our sight.

Windows will the heat of the sun,
Their work is never done.
Bringing in the outside,
Holding firm what is inside.

And so goes in the nightly tide
As the skies blue mouth opens wide.
Greeting icy streets
That fit perfectly upon the streets-

Melting moods and puddles of ice
In the unhurried break of day.
This all happening as I lay
Beside my still dreaming wife.

Night has not yet left her
Reality and dreams together,
Yet as she stirs,
It occurs that our lives will not last forever.
